Some interesting results from a study done by Improve Podcasts, conducted as an online survey in Q1 2021 and received responses from 1,076 people who self-identified as podcasters, the majority of whom were located in the U.S.

Why I want to spotlight this study is this - many of the podcasting statistics were surprising. But also shed a lot of light on the current state of podcasting, and points toward new future trends.

Here are the TOP 12 Actionable Highlights, Trends, and Podcasting Statistics.
